We have Lake Biwa in shiga, and which is the biggest Lake in Japan.
For visitors who are not interested in traditional or countriside(interedtied in jsut High technology of Jpn), these are not fun.
I am not prenty knowleage of shiga , but I need to recomferm shiga is also historical place.
There were many small temple or shrine in Shiga.
Most of temples are highly close adherence to community.
Kyoto is well know as historical place and recently I saw too many visitor around kyoto-station. I also travel to Kyoto to see temple, shrine, museum, and really convinient to morern.
But, some staying in Japan for a long time told me Shiga is also nice place to relax, and have a nice view.
Here is next to Kyoto, so If you have a enough time, nice to visit there. Or tired to clowded or poluted places, nice place to relax and enjoy beautiful view.
There is Ukimi-do temple south west side of Lake Biwa. I visit here once a year since 2002(I might visit again this year more).
And here is one of my favorate place. View is nice,
According to people who lives near hear, snow season is also nice.
